ERA’s Technical Committee has released an additional document on training for engineers.

A few years ago, the document “Training – Education and Technical Training for Rental Companies” was produced, identifying four levels of training corresponding to four levels of maintenance.

With levels 1 and 2 relevant to rental, the rental companies on the Committee decided to set frameworks for those levels to help OEMs provide them with the right information and materials to improve their training.

They started with an example of a checklist for a level 1 engineer and they are now publishing a checklist relevant to the needs of a level 2 engineer.
